REDHAT CLUSTER SUIT COMPONENTS
Cluster infrastructure
Basic functions to work as a cluster
High-availability Service Management
Provide failover services from one node to other
Cluster administration tools
Setting up ,configuring, Management cluster
Linux Virtual Server (LVS)
For IP Load Balancing
3rd Party components
GFS/GFS2 -Cluster file system used with RHCS
CLVM -Cluster logical volume manager –Volume management with RHCS
GNBD -Global Network Block Device – making available of block storage to GFS

FENCING
Disconnection of node from cluster’s shared
storage
o Power fencing
integrate
HP ilo,DRAC/MC,Blade centers
external
WTI power controllers
o SCSI3 Persistent Reservation Fencing
o Fiber Channel switch fencing
o GNBD Fencing

CLUSTER CREATION WITH PCS
Pacemaker is cluster resource manager
detection of services-level or node failure &
recovery
No requirement of shared storage
Support quorate & resource driven clusters
support service types
Clones : service should up in multiple
nodes
Multi-state service with multi-mode
#yum install pcs fence-agents
#pcs cluster auth node1 node2 -u hacluster –p
password
#pcs cluster --start –name clustername node1 node2
#pcs cluster enable –all
